Protobuf
Developers should learn and use Protobuf when building high-performance, scalable distributed systems, microservices, or APIs where efficient data serialization and low latency are critical, such as in real-time applications, IoT devices, or large-scale data processing pipelines

XML API
Developers should learn XML APIs when working with legacy systems, enterprise applications, or industries like finance and healthcare where XML is a mandated standard
